About this cut

The tail, cut into thick cross-sections exposing a central bone surrounded by rich, gelatinous meat. One of the most universally recognized cuts across all cultures. Ideal for slow braising — produces extraordinarily rich, collagen-heavy broth.

Moroccan taste is firmly Well Done due to the dominance of slow-cooked tajines. Saigant (rare) is French-influenced and rarely ordered outside Casablanca/Marrakech tourist restaurants.
